Double-Glazed Unit Fitting


Installing energy-saving glazing is one of the most cost-effective moves for Woodinville WA homeowners facing drafts. These windows use two layers of glass with a sealed gap—often filled with argon or air—to improve window insulation and cut your heating and cooling bills.

Energy-Efficient Glass Upgrades


Upgrading to high-performance glazing can deliver significant home energy savings—especially in Woodinville’s variable climate. These windows often feature low-E coatings, warm-edge spacers, and superior seals that boost thermal performance while slashing your utility costs.

Quiet Glazing for Serene Living Spaces


If you're near busy roads, schools, or wooded areas with frequent wildlife noise, noise-reducing windows can noticeably improve your comfort. These windows use layered glass, specialized framing, and tight seals to reduce outside noise—perfect for creating a quiet retreat.

Outswing and Lateral Frames


Hinged glazing open wide with a crank, offering unobstructed ventilation and excellent air sealing when closed. Lateral frames are space-saving, perfect for patios, balconies, or narrow walls.

Bay and Bow Window Options


Bay windows add space, light, and architectural interest—ideal for breakfast nooks or living rooms. Bow windows create a soft, flowing silhouette with three to five panes in a gentle arc.

Picture Units for Landscape Appreciation


For homes nestled near forests, lakes, or hills, scenic units are a game-changer. These non-opening windows are designed to highlight your outdoor scenery like a living painting.

Because they don’t open, they offer excellent window insulation and draft-free performance—perfect for Woodinville’s wet seasons. Pair them with energy-efficient glass for year-round comfort.

Zoning Rules in Woodinville


Window replacement in Woodinville WA may require a city approval, especially for structural changes, egress windows, or historic districts. Skipping permits can lead to fines or issues when selling.

Affordable Window Upgrade Costs in Woodinville WA


Typical Pricing by Window Style


The replacement price in Woodinville WA varies by material, with vinyl windows averaging budget-friendly rates than wood windows or custom window sizes. For example, double-hung windows typically range from $400–$700 each, while bay windows or bow windows can run $1,200–$2,500 due to installation labor.


  • Double-pane windows start at $350–$600 per unit

  • Casement windows average $500–$800 installed

  • View-maximizing units cost $600–$1,400 depending on dimensions
